Summer Day Camp Program Coordinator Job Description
Objective:
Develop, implement and evaluate multi day camps for kindergarten through 5th graders that will lead to future participation in special interest 4-H clubs.
Assist in preparation and implementation of 4-H and youth activities at the local county fair.
Employment:
This is a temporary, part time position beginning approximately April 1, 2013 (online until college is over for the year) and ending when responsibilities are completed, but no later than mid- August, 2013. Exact employment dates will be determined and agreed upon by employee and employer.
Work hours shall be flexible to best achieve the objective. Total hour worked shall be a minimum of 250 hours and may be more. The employee shall work no more than 40 hours in any one week.
Report to local county extension council
Responsibilities Include:
Complete planning curriculum for day camps.
- Participate in assigned training.
- Develop promotional materials and recruitment strategies for youth to participate in day camps.
- Manage registration process and maintain attendance records and Medical/Release forms.
- Recruit and assist in training of adult and youth volunteers.
- Obtain needed supplies and equipment.
- Carry out planned activities to recruit youth to join 4-H.
- Conduct day camps
- Coordinate efforts to report the day camp program both externally- to the community and highlight camp themes and club opportunities, and internally to Iowa 4-H.
- Maintain complete record of 2013 County Extension Summer Day Camp program, detailing activities, and attendance, evaluation and media efforts.
- Assist with county planning, development and implementation of the local county fair
